Top Pet Store In Mount Waddington | Reviews & Ratings | vimarsana.com

Pet store in mount waddington in Canada - V0N2R0/ near port-mcneill/ near port-mcneill

Pet store in mount waddington in Canada - / near mount-waddington

Pet store in mount waddington in Canada - v0n/ near mount-waddington